Re: The Secret Behind "Cheap Mediatek Chips" by PhonePlanet(m): 4:16pm On Dec 07, 2015
kolabad:
agreed d m9+ doesn't do well against against d s6 and d g4 but according 2 ur previous post u sed if we are 2 compare any qhd mediatek device wif anoda dah is using snapdragon d mediatek device wud flop.. Even though d s6 nd g4 outperformed d m9+ I feel dere re still oder qhd snapdragon devices d m9+ outperforms...
And I am telling you there is non!

ANTUTU (higher is better)

In descending order
Galaxy S6 active = 71865 (Exynos)
Galaxy S6 Edge+ = 69306 (Exynos)
Galaxy S6 Edge = 69042 (Exynos)
Galaxy Note 5 = 67207 (Exynos)
Nexus 6P = 60007 (Snapdragon 810)
Galaxy S6 = 58382 (Exynos)
Mi Note Pro = 53798 (Snapdragon 810)
ZTE Axon Pro = 53535 (Snapdragon 810)
Droid Turbo 2 = 52201 (Snapdragon 810)
Xperia Z5 Premium = 52189 (Snapdragon 810)
Moto X Pure = 51822 (Snapdragon 808)
LG G4 = 50330 (Snapdragon 808)
Blackberry Priv = 48212 (Snapdragon 808)
HTC M9+ = 47862 (Mediatek)
LG V10 = 46905 (Snapdragon 808)


Note: that these are only QHD phones are many other phones (even more than this list) falls in before the HTC m9+
Also Note: Snapdragon 808 was Qualcomm previous flagship before Snapdragon 810.

http://www.phonearena.com/phones/benchmarks
